In a world where the divine often feels distant and abstract, The Living God by Kaushik Mohanty arrives as a compelling reminder that divinity can be profoundly human, intimately present, and woven into the rhythms of daily life. This book is not merely a retelling of legends or a compilation of religious facts—it is an immersive journey into the mystery, culture, devotion, and living heartbeat of Shree Jagannath, the revered deity of Puri. Through meticulous research and heartfelt narration, the author guides readers into the sacred geography of Shree Kshetra, where the infinite becomes accessible, and the divine is embraced as a family member rather than a far-removed celestial being.

At the core of the book is a powerful thought—what if the Lord of the Universe is not just worshipped but lived with? What if He experiences illness, receives special offerings, and welcomes His devotees as kin? Mohanty explores this extraordinary intimacy through the traditions surrounding the “Living God,” showcasing how Lord Jagannath’s rituals blur the line between the mortal and the divine. From the world’s largest kitchen serving millions with divine precision to the temple’s architectural marvels rooted in ancient geometry, each chapter illuminates aspects of a deity who is alive in culture, community, and consciousness.

The book delves deep into the centuries-old customs that define Jagannath culture—rituals where kings sweep the streets in humility, grand festivals that transform the town into a cosmic theatre, and ancient martial traditions that continue to protect sacred wisdom. Readers are taken behind the scenes of the awe-inspiring Nabakalebara ceremony, where the deity undergoes a mystical rebirth, symbolizing the profound concept of impermanence within immortality. Through these explorations, Mohanty captures the essence of a faith that has endured invasions, societal shifts, and the test of time—yet remains vibrant, resilient, and universally inviting.
